Eat in the Streets will have a Halloween theme in Avondale on Oct. 30 and 31

BIRMINGHAM, ALABAMA — Oct. 30, 2020 —  Eat in the Streets will have a Halloween theme this Friday and Saturday as it moves to Avondale and offers a long block party known as Peaches and Scream.

Eat in the Streets allows consumers to social distance while dining outdoors. Forty-First Street South will be closed between First Avenue South and Fifth Avenue South. Hours for Eat in the Streets will be Friday, Oct. 30 from 5 p.m. to 11 p.m. and Saturday, Oct. 31 from 11 a.m. to 11 p.m.

On Saturday, there will be a Halloween costume contest, starting around 4 p.m. for children near the Melt restaurant. An adult costume contest will be held near Avondale Brewing during the Alabama halftime game. The game will start at 6 p.m. Avondale Brewing will show the game on two big screen TVs. There will also be pet category for the Halloween contest.

Avondale Brewing will closed on Friday for a sold concert, but will be open on Saturday for Peaches and Scream. Businesses will pass out candy to children on Friday and Saturday.

Participating restaurants will include: Avondale Brewing Co., Avondale Burger Company Luna, 41st St Pub, Fancy’s on Fifth, Melt, Spring Street Grill, Avondale Common House, Cookie Dough Magic, Saw’s Soul Kitchen and Post Office Pies.
